  • Bedrug replacement Jeep carpet test and review! I installed Bedrug in my Jeep over two years ago. After numerous Moab & Colorado trips, my Jeep's carpet looks phenomenal. The Bedrug carpet isn't worn and looks new. This review was not sponsored or endorsed by Bedrug. I like the carpets so much I decided to review them.
